This undated Civil War era store card, cataloged as Fuld 730A-8a, is a copper patriotic edition token issued by Drs. Brown & Dills of Ohio. The issuer's title indicates a medical practice, making this one of the relatively few Civil War tokens issued by healthcare professionals rather than retail merchants or manufacturers. Ohio was one of the most prolific sources of Civil War tokens, with Cincinnati serving as a major die-sinking center second only to New York in production volume. The medical partnership of Brown & Dills used this token for both emergency currency and professional advertising, a practice that would be considered unusual for physicians today but was common in the less regulated medical marketplace of the 1860s. The copper composition is the standard for Civil War tokens designated with the "a" suffix.
